Abstract
Provided is an attractor based on siphonage, belonging to a medical appliance for internal medicine. The attractor comprises a water inlet pipe (1), a water outlet pipe (2), and an electric pump (3) connected with the water inlet pipe (1) and the water outlet pipe (2), the water inlet of the water inlet pipe (1) is higher than the water outlet of the water outlet pipe (2), the water inlet of the water inlet pipe (1) faces downwards, and the electric pump (3) is configured at the highest position of the attractor. By using such an attractor, the electric pump (3) is turned off after the initial work of drainage is completed, and the drainage work continues by means of siphonage without the need for power supply, thereby saving energy.
Description
Technical field
Suction pump based on siphonage belongs to the internal medicine medical instruments.
Background technology
Existing suction pump all needs power set, such as pump.The effect of pump provides the power of liquid flow, if want to continue to finish attraction work, will continue to provide electric energy to pump, and the mode of this continued power must cause the waste of resource.
The utility model content
In order to address the above problem, this utility model has designed a kind of suction pump based on siphonage, and this suction pump is closed pump after finishing the drain initialization, utilize siphonage, and drain work is continued, and need not to provide continuously power supply, energy savings.
The purpose of this utility model is achieved in that
Suction pump based on siphonage includes water pipe, outlet pipe, and the electric pump that is connected with outlet pipe with oral siphon, the water inlet of oral siphon is higher than the outlet of outlet pipe, the water inlet direction of oral siphon down, electric pump is configured in the highest position of suction pump.
Above-mentioned suction pump based on siphonage also includes connection tube and connects into water pipe and outlet pipe respectively, and in parallel with electric pump.
Above-mentioned suction pump based on siphonage disposes valve on the described connection tube.
Because this utility model suction pump includes water pipe, outlet pipe, and the electric pump that is connected with outlet pipe with oral siphon, the water inlet of oral siphon is higher than the outlet of outlet pipe, and electric pump is configured in the highest position of suction pump; This design makes this drainage device after finishing the drain initialization, closes electric pump, utilizes siphonage, and drain work is continued, and need not to provide continuously power supply, energy savings.
Description of drawings
Fig. 1 is this utility model suction pump structural representation.
Among the figure: 1 oral siphon, 2 outlet pipes, 3 electric pumps, 4 connection tubes, 5 valves.
The specific embodiment
Below in conjunction with accompanying drawing this utility model specific embodiment is described in further detail.
Present embodiment based on the suction pump structural representation of siphonage as shown in Figure 1, this suction pump includes water pipe 1, outlet pipe 2, and the electric pump 3 that is connected with outlet pipe 2 with oral siphon 1, the water inlet of oral siphon 1 is higher than the outlet of outlet pipe 2, the water inlet direction of oral siphon (1) down, electric pump 3 is configured in the highest position of suction pump.Above-mentioned suction pump also includes connection tube 4 and connects into water pipe 1 and outlet pipe 2 respectively, and in parallel with electric pump 3, disposes valve 5 on this connection tube 4.
When in use, make liquid earlier through oral siphon 1 by electric pump 3 earlier, flow out through outlet pipe 2 backs again, after finishing the initialization of this drain, open valve 5 and close electric pump 3, because the liquid inertia effect makes that liquid will be by oral siphon 1, again through being flowed out by outlet pipe 2 behind the connection tube 4.Utilize siphonage, drain work is continued, need not to provide continuously power supply, energy savings.
